With the rising value of Bitcoin, investing in mining hardware can be tempting. Unfortunately, the market is also flooded with sophisticated scams and counterfeit machines. Purchasing a fake or defective miner can lead to significant financial loss. This guide provides seven crucial steps to verify the authenticity of a Bitcoin mining machine before you buy.

First, research the seller meticulously. Always purchase from authorized distributors or highly reputable, established vendors. Check online reviews, forum discussions, and Better Business Bureau ratings. Be extremely wary of deals on general marketplaces like eBay or Facebook Marketplace that seem "too good to be true" – they often are. Scammers frequently use stolen images and fake specifications to lure unsuspecting buyers.

Second, verify the hardware specifications physically. Before payment, inspect the machine. Check the brand, model number, and serial number on the device itself. Compare these details to the official specifications on the manufacturer's website (e.g., Bitmain, MicroBT). Look for any signs of poor craftsmanship, mismatched components, or reused parts. Authentic miners have robust build quality and consistent branding.

Third, test the hash rate and efficiency. A real miner's performance should match its advertised hash rate and power consumption. If possible, request a live video demonstration of the machine hashing at a mining pool or use escrow services that verify functionality before releasing funds. A significant deviation from the stated specs is a major red flag.

Fourth, check the firmware and software. Authentic Bitcoin miners run official firmware from the manufacturer. Upon startup, you should be able to access a control panel that matches the brand's interface. Counterfeit machines may use modified or generic firmware. Attempt to update the firmware from the official source; if it fails or isn't recognized, the hardware is likely fake.

Fifth, scrutinize the power supply unit (PSU). High-quality mining requires a reliable, high-wattage PSU. Many scammers pair a fake miner with a low-quality, dangerous power supply. Ensure the PSU brand and wattage are correct for the model and come from a reputable manufacturer. Mismatched or unbranded PSUs are a clear warning sign.

Sixth, validate the packaging and accessories. Genuine products come in professional packaging with security seals, manuals, and all necessary cables. Poor-quality printing, missing logos, flimsy boxes, or absent accessories suggest a counterfeit product.

Seventh, use secure payment methods. Never pay with irreversible methods like wire transfers, gift cards, or cryptocurrency sent directly to a seller's wallet. Use credit cards or payment platforms that offer buyer protection. Escrow services are highly recommended for large private sales, as they hold payment until the machine is verified.
